  • the present invention relates to a device for the presentation of visual information carriers, in particular brochures, posters and similar image and / or writing carriers, as well as essentially flat objects, as well as numerical or alphanumeric display units such as illuminated letters, electronic displays and the like.
  • shop windows There are a number of lines of business that can show little or no actual merchandise in their shop windows, which refer to the business activity for the purpose of advertising. These are primarily banks, insurance companies, travel agencies and similar service providers that rely on the use of written and visual information media for their advertising activities. The same applies, of course, in addition to the shop windows for counter rooms, business premises and the like of such businesses.
  • shop windows in particular, it is problematic to realize an appealing presentation with such written or visual information or advertising media, which can have a certain spatial depth effect and thereby the available space, both in height and in depth, optimally exploited.
  • an attractively and diversely designed shop window arouses the interest of potential customers to a much greater extent and thus brings about a much better effect or a more thorough communication of information.
  • this is achieved in a device of the type mentioned at the outset in that a plurality of base elements which are connected to one another at equal intervals and are provided with slots and a plurality of support members which are designed in the manner of plates at least in an edge region and which support the information carriers, the latter being provided at least the plate-like edge areas of all support members are identical in shape and dimensions and can be inserted into the slots of the base elements.
  • a kind of "modular system” is thus created, so that the device can be easily adapted to different window sizes and can be provided in a varied manner with optionally differently designed, interchangeably arranged support members.
  • the level of attention is considerably increased due to the varied arrangement of the support elements.
  • a simple to manufacture, inexpensive embodiment of the device can be realized in that the base elements are formed by elongated, essentially cuboid bodies which are connected to one another in the region of an end face by spacers, optionally detachably.
  • the opposite end surface, which then expediently forms the front surface of the base elements, is advantageously beveled, on the one hand to provide a more pleasing appearance, and on the other hand to present itself in a more favorable viewing angle if it is additionally printed or otherwise labeled.
  • the slots starting from the upper end face of the base elements, run parallel to the beveled front end face and are continuous with respect to the two side faces of the base elements.
  • the oblique arrangement means that an inserted support member is held in a defined position if the slots are significantly wider than the thickness of the edge area of the support member; this is desirable for reasons of easy interchangeability.
  • the slots running from one side surface to the other allow support members to be accommodated on both sides, which then only take up half the slot width.
  • the device comprises a plurality of base elements 1 which essentially have the shape of elongated, cuboid bodies.
  • base elements 1 which essentially have the shape of elongated, cuboid bodies.
  • spacers 3 which are detachably attached to the base elements 1, for example by means of schematically indicated screws 4.
  • a base is formed which consists of a plurality of base elements 1 and the associated spacers 3 which are arranged next to one another at uniform intervals.
  • Each of the base elements 1 is equipped with a plurality of slots 5 arranged one behind the other at a distance; these extend obliquely downwards from the upper end face 6 of the base elements 1 and end at a certain distance above the lower contact surface 7 of the elements 1.
  • the slots 5 extend continuously over the entire width of the elements 1.
  • the front end face 8 of the elements 1 is also beveled, preferably running parallel to the slots 5. The purpose of this bevel will be explained below.
  • FIG. 1 Two support members are shown in FIG. 1, which are designated overall by 9a and 9b.
  • Each of these support members comprises a support area 10a or 10b and an edge area 11a or 11b, which each consist of a flat, plate-like element.
  • the edge region 11a is kinked along a line 12 with respect to the support region 10a, approximately at an angle which corresponds to the course of the slanted slots 5.
  • the edge region 11a is provided with a protruding tongue 13a, the width of which is somewhat less than the width of the actual edge region and at least approximately corresponds to the distance between mutually facing side surfaces of adjacent base elements 1.
  • the width of the actual edge area is expediently chosen in accordance with the center distance between adjacent base elements. Again, exactly the same applies to the support member 9b.
  • This design creates a natural stop when the support members 9a and 9b are pushed into the base elements 1 by the edge-side end edges of the edge regions 11a and 11b abutting the bottom of the slots 5.
  • the support members are necessarily centered in the base in this way.
  • the width of the slots 5 is expediently significantly greater than the thickness of the material of the edge regions 11a and 11b, so that the support members 9a and 9b can be easily inserted into the slots 5 and pulled out again.
  • the inclined arrangement of the slots 5 with a corresponding kinking of the edge areas 11a and 11b inevitably results in a stable, well-defined position of the individual support members in the base, even if the slots 5 are considerably wider than the edge areas of the support members. This not only benefits stability, but also ensures an orderly appearance of the device.
  • the height of the support area 10a of the support member 9a is less than that of the support area 10b of the support member 9b.
  • the support member 9a in a view from behind, together with an information carrier 14 which is to be applied to the support area 10a of the support member 9a.
  • the information carrier 14 e.g. a printed poster made of cardboard, pre-folded flaps 15 arranged on both sides, which are folded around the two edges of the carrying area 10a and held in place by means of clamping members 16. This ensures that the information carriers 14 are easy to replace.
  • FIG 3 shows a first exemplary embodiment of the device, specifically only in the minimal configuration, ie with a single pair of base elements 1, which are held together by a spacer (which cannot be seen in the drawing).
  • a first support member 17 is inserted into the slots 5 at the front and a second support member 18 behind.
  • these support members are constructed in the same way as described in connection with FIGS. 1 and 2, in particular as far as the formation of the edge area is concerned.
  • the front, lower support member 17, however, is still equipped with a storage area 19 which is bent vertically from the upper edge of the support area towards the rear. This provides an additional, horizontal storage area create on which smaller items 20 can be presented.
  • At least the support area of these support members 17 and 18 can be made of a ferromagnetic material, for example of sheet iron, so that information carriers 22 can be attached by means of small magnets 21. This solution is particularly recommended if the information carriers have to be replaced frequently, e.g. course lists from a bank or the like.
  • the exemplary embodiment according to FIG. 4 is also particularly suitable for the latter application area.
  • two support members 24 and 25, which are connected to one another by an intermediate member 23, are provided, the edge region of which is configured as described above and is inserted into slots 5 of the pair of base elements 1.
  • the intermediate member 23 can contain a mechanically or electronically controlled display unit, the display of which is visible through windows or openings 26 provided in the front support member. Unchangeable information is printed on the support area of the support member 24 next to the windows.
  • Such a solution is ideal for displaying frequently changing currency exchange rates.
  • FIG. 5 shows a further exemplary embodiment of the device according to the invention, which is basically constructed in the same way as the variants described above.
  • the rear support member 27 is, however, designed to be pivotable, in such a way that the support area can be pivoted 90 degrees relative to the rear area and locked in the normal position.
  • the pivoted position is indicated by dashed lines in the drawing.
  • FIG. 6 A further embodiment variant is shown in FIG. 6.
  • three front support members 30, 31 and 32 are connected to rear support members 34 by means of an intermediate member 33.
  • the respective edge areas are designed analogously to that previously described and are received in the slots 5 of the base elements 1.
  • the front of the support areas of the individual support members 30-32 are printed with a world map, with selected locations, e.g. in addition to some major cities, windows 34 are left out.
  • the intermediate link 33 can contain a number of clock units in such a way that the respective local times can be seen through the windows 34.
  • FIG. 7 A last variant is finally shown in FIG. 7, where the support members serve to carry a screen viewing device, for example a data monitor or a television set 35.
  • a screen viewing device for example a data monitor or a television set 35.
  • Four support members 36 the edge regions of which are designed analogously to those previously described, are arranged one behind the other in the base, which is formed by the base elements 1 and the spacer (not shown) and held by the slots 5.
  • the comparatively heavy device 35 is fixed to the support areas of the four Support members 36 connected and thus securely supported.
  • the edge areas can also be attached with a fixed, e.g. printed pictorial and / or textual representation, such as the name of the bank, the logo of the travel agency or the like.
  • a fixed e.g. printed pictorial and / or textual representation, such as the name of the bank, the logo of the travel agency or the like.
  • the inclined arrangement also makes it easier to view such additional information content.
  • edge area is identical for all support members used within the same overall device. This ensures compatibility, which in turn enables a varied design of the information and advertising medium, in that each of the support members can be inserted into any desired pair of base elements at any location.
  • the device can be adapted to almost any desired window width by appropriate selection of the spacers.
  • the modular structure of the device with a few basic elements ensures that it can meet a wide variety of needs. There are also hardly any limits in the choice of materials; the base elements and the supporting elements can be made of wood, plastic, metal or acrylic glass in a wide variety of variants.
